Deciding between a coworking space and a private office is a significant decision for any growing enterprise . Coworking spaces offer a dynamic atmosphere, lower costs, and immediate access to a network of individuals, making them advantageous for freelancers . On the other hand, a private office provides increased confidentiality , enhanced image , and a dedicated setting , which can be vital for established organizations or those requiring confidential information .

Individual Workspaces in Co-working Spaces: The Ideal of Both Realities?
The rising popularity of private offices within shared workspaces presents a unique proposition for companies. Traditionally, businesses opted for either a fully private office suite, offering complete privacy, or a flexible co-working space, providing a dynamic atmosphere and reduced overhead. However, this evolving model attempts to bridge the disparity between the two. You can gain the benefits of a dedicated workspace – seclusion for confidential work, concentrated meetings, and a businesslike image – while still accessing the collaboration and amenities usually found in a co-working setting.
Consider these likely advantages:
- Increased Privacy
- Better Branding
- Ability to network with other professionals
- Minimized overhead compared to a traditional private office
- Flexibility in rental agreements
Ultimately, whether private offices in shared spaces are truly the "best of both worlds" depends on the particular requirements and preferences of the tenant.
